…proxy (Batch 2 of 4) (#7520)

# What is the reason for the change?
- Implement a new metrics system for the Segment SDK.
- Make it work alongside the old one so that we can remove the old one
progressively.

# What is the improvement/solution?
- Create a new class to handle metrics with segment
- abstract all segment SDK calls
- provide our own user and anonymous Ids for improved privacy
- Reuse the Mixpanel user id it available, otherwise generates a new one
with the same format
- patch Segment SDK to allow the privacy aware user and anonymous Ids
- No event sent at all if user haven't accepted to send metrics info
- Total reset of the infos in case user asks to reset (in settings)
- Ability to disable all metrics
- Ability to ask for deletion of all data

What is new author?

A new npm collaborator published a version of the package for the first time. New collaborators are usually benign additions to a project, but do indicate a change to the security surface area of a package.

Scrutinize new collaborator additions to packages because they now have the ability to publish code into your dependency tree. Packages should avoid frequent or unnecessary additions or changes to publishing rights.

What is a deprecated package?

The maintainer of the package marked it as deprecated. This could indicate that a single version should not be used, or that the package is no longer maintained and any new vulnerabilities will not be fixed.

Research the state of the package and determine if there are non-deprecated versions that can be used, or if it should be replaced with a new, supported solution.
